Explosion Halts Operations at Iraq Oil Field: US Company

An explosion at an oil field in Iraq's autonomous Kurdistan region on Tuesday suspended operations, said the US company operating the field.


HKN Energy said in a statement that "an explosion occurred earlier today at approximately 7:00 AM local time (0400 GMT) at one of its production facilities in the Sarang field." It added that "operations at the affected facility have been suspended until the site is secured." The cause of the explosion was not immediately clear, reports BSS.
